BBVA taps Surecomp’s RIVO to modernise global trade operations
By Vriti Gothi

BBVA has expanded its digital trade finance capabilities by integrating Surecomp’s RIVO™, a multi-bank platform designed to streamline processing, enhance visibility and centralise communication for corporate clients engaged in international trade. The move reflects the bank’s broader strategy to modernise its global trade operations through greater interoperability and real-time connectivity.
With RIVO™, BBVA’s corporate customers will be able to submit applications for letters of credit and guarantees entirely online, while consolidating interactions with multiple financial institutions via a single portal. The platform aims to reduce operational friction in trade documentation and support more efficient, secure and traceable cross-border transactions.
The integration adds to BBVA’s ongoing digital initiatives, which include developing API-driven infrastructure and exploring new connectivity models such as a guarantees-management pilot through Swift’s Gateway, unveiled earlier this year at Sibos. These efforts signal the bank’s intent to play a more prominent role in shaping the next generation of digital trade networks.
